1. Dashboard
  2. Mitglieder
    1. Letzte Aktivitäten
    2. Benutzer online
    3. Team
    4. Mitgliedersuche
  3. Forenregeln
  4. Forum
    1. Unerledigte Themen
  • Anmelden
  • Registrieren
  • Suche
Alles
  • Alles
  • Artikel
  • Seiten
  • Forum
  • Erweiterte Suche
  1. AutoIt.de - Das deutschsprachige Forum.
  2. Mitglieder
  3. Greenhorn

Beiträge von Greenhorn

  • Board-Bug ???

    • Greenhorn
    • 3. März 2008 um 20:24

    Beim Abmelden isses weg ..., beim Anmelden wieder da ...
    Minesweeper in 2D.rar10Std.zip
    Ganz vergessen ..., Firefox benutze ich.
    Werde es gleich noch einmal mit OperaUSB versuchen ...

    Dateien

    Startseite - .- autoit.de -. - Das deutsche AutoIt-Forum.png 383,75 kB – 0 Downloads OFF_Startseite - .- autoit.de -. - Das deutsche AutoIt-Forum.png 292,62 kB – 0 Downloads
  • Board-Bug ???

    • Greenhorn
    • 3. März 2008 um 18:15

    Hi Admins,

    ich habe seit heute zwei Shoutboxen auf der Startseite (davon ist eine leer ...), aber nur wenn ich angemeldet bin.

    Ist es bei euch/Anderen auch so ???


    Gruß
    Greenhorn

  • Process Information

    • Greenhorn
    • 1. März 2008 um 21:21
    Zitat von akira2012
    Code
    ERROR: _GUICtrlListView_SortItems(): undefined function.
            	_GUICtrlListView_SortItems($ListView, GUICtrlGetState($ListView))

    Du musst die beta 3.2.11.0 oder höher benutzen. ;)

    Gruß
    Greenhorn

  • Blaumacher :D eigene func in scite über properties färben

    • Greenhorn
    • 1. März 2008 um 20:55

    Das kann man doch über SciTE Config machen ...

    White Space ändern und dann habe ich auch meine Func's in einer anderen Farbe ...

    SciTEUser.properties

    Spoiler anzeigen
    Code
    #-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
    # START: DO NOT CHANGE ANYTHING AFTER THIS LINE     #-#-#-#-#
    # Created by SciTEConfig
    #------------------------------------------------------------
    font.base=font:Verdana,size:10,$(font.override)
    font.monospace=font:Courier New,size:10
    proper.case=0
    check.updates.scite4autoit3=0
    use.tabs=1
    indent.size=4
    indent.size.*.au3=4
    tabsize=4
    #Background
    style.au3.32=style.*.32=$(font.base)
    #CaretLineBackground
    caret.line.back=#FFFED8
    # Brace highlight
    style.au3.34=fore:#0000FF,bold
    # Brace incomplete highlight
    style.au3.35=fore:#009933,italics
    #White space
    style.au3.0=fore:#47DBF5,italics,bold,back:#ffffff
    #Comment line
    style.au3.1=fore:#009933,italics,back:#ffffff
    #Comment block
    style.au3.2=fore:#669900,italics,back:#ffffff
    #Number
    style.au3.3=fore:#AC00A9,italics,bold,back:#ffffff
    #Function
    style.au3.4=fore:#000090,italics,bold,back:#ffffff
    #Keyword
    style.au3.5=fore:#0000FF,bold,back:#ffffff
    #Macro
    style.au3.6=fore:#FF33FF,bold,back:#ffffff
    #String
    style.au3.7=fore:#9999CC,bold,back:#ffffff
    #Operator
    style.au3.8=fore:#FF0000,bold,back:#ffffff
    #Variable
    style.au3.9=fore:#AA0000,bold,back:#ffffff
    #Sent keys
    style.au3.10=fore:#FF8800,bold,back:#ffffff
    #Pre-Processor
    style.au3.11=fore:#F000FF,italics,back:#ffffff
    #Special
    style.au3.12=fore:#A00FF0,italics,back:#ffffff
    #Abbrev-Expand
    style.au3.13=fore:#FF0000,bold,back:#ffffff
    #Com Objects
    style.au3.14=fore:#0000FF,italics,bold,back:#ffffff
    #Standard UDF's
    style.au3.15=fore:#0080FF,italics,bold,back:#ffffff
    # END => DO NOT CHANGE ANYTHING BEFORE THIS LINE  #-#-#-#-#-#
    #-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#-#
    Alles anzeigen


    Gruß
    Greenhorn

  • Bildschirmschoner in Autoit erstellen?

    • Greenhorn
    • 1. März 2008 um 15:54

    Anscheinend hat Johannes die Antwort schon bekommen ...
    http://www.autoitscript.com/forum/index.php?s=&showtopic=65474&view=findpost&p=486536

    [autoit]

    #include <GUIConstants.au3>
    ;first edition of an screen saver
    $font='Arial'
    $textcolor = 0xff0000

    [/autoit][autoit][/autoit][autoit]

    GUICreate('', -1, -1, 0, 0, BitOr($WS_POPUP, $WS_MAXIMIZE))
    ; paradies.jpg exists under W2K, XP has other filenames, the directory is the same
    $pic1 = GUICtrlCreatePic(@WindowsDir & '\Web\Wallpaper\paradies.jpg', 0, 0, @DesktopWidth, @DesktopHeight)
    $label1=GUICtrlCreateLabel ('This is only a sample of a text for a screen saver', 10, 80, @DesktopWidth -20, @DesktopHeight-180, $SS_CENTERIMAGE )
    GUICtrlSetBkColor(-1, $GUI_BKCOLOR_TRANSPARENT)
    GUICtrlSetColor ( -1, $textcolor)

    [/autoit][autoit][/autoit][autoit][/autoit][autoit]

    GUICtrlSetFont (-1, 36, 400, 1, $font)
    GUISetState (@SW_SHOW)

    [/autoit][autoit][/autoit][autoit]

    While 1
    $msg = GUIGetMsg()

    If $msg = $GUI_EVENT_CLOSE Then ExitLoop
    Wend

    [/autoit]
  • Bildschirmschoner in Autoit erstellen?

    • Greenhorn
    • 1. März 2008 um 15:11
    Zitat

    aber btw, wo sind denn bitteschon all die "*.src" file?

    [autoit]

    @SystemDir

    [/autoit]

    Gruß
    Greenhorn

  • Script mit Tasten STARTEN und beenden...

    • Greenhorn
    • 1. März 2008 um 15:07
    Zitat

    nebener punkt2 im oberen Post wäre noch nett, das nerft mich, da fehlt sicher nur irgendwo ein Zeichen das es so klappt wie ich will..

    While ... Then gibt es nicht. If _IsPressed Then ... . ;)

    Gruß

  • Script mit Tasten STARTEN und beenden...

    • Greenhorn
    • 1. März 2008 um 14:01
    Zitat

    Greenhorn

    Ich habe echt keine Ahnung was ich mit diesem Monster anfangen soll, filecreateshortcut habe ich in der hilfe nachgeschlagen, keine Ahnung was man damit machen kann und was das bezwecken soll...


    Wer lesen kann ist klar im Vorteil ... :D
    Damit setzt Du einen Hotkey global für dein Script, egal welches Fenster gerade aktiv ist !
    Das ist doch das was Du wolltest, oder etwa nicht !?

    Wenn Du aus den While-Schleifen den Sleep einfach herausnimmst, dann solltest Du deine CPU-Auslastung im Auge behalten ... ;)

    Gruß

  • Script mit Tasten STARTEN und beenden...

    • Greenhorn
    • 1. März 2008 um 00:34

    Das hier wäre auch noch eine Alternative zum setzen des Start-Hotkey ... ;)

    [autoit]

    ; Sets a shortcut with ctrl+alt+t hotkey
    FileCreateShortcut(@ScriptDir & '\Script.exe', _ ; Pfad zu deiner *.exe
    @DesktopDir & '\Script.lnk', _ ; Name der Verknüpfung
    @ScriptDir, _ ; Working Dir (optional)
    '', _ ; zusätzliche Argumente (optional)
    'Dies ist mein Hotkey-Hook;-)', _ ; Kommentar (optional)
    @ScriptDir & '\Script.exe', _ ; Icon (optional)
    '^!t', _ ; HotKey !!! (optional)
    '0', _ ; Iconnummer (optional)
    @SW_MINIMIZE) ; Fensterstatus (optional)

    [/autoit]

    Gruß
    Greenhorn

  • Anfänger hat Frage zu AutoIT, Schwerpunkt Winactivate

    • Greenhorn
    • 29. Februar 2008 um 23:56

    Es reicht, wenn Du einen Teil oder den Anfang des Fenstertextes angibst ! ;)

    [autoit]

    WinActivate('Setup', 'Setupsprache: &Deutsch')
    ControlClick('Setup', 'Setupsprache: &Deutsch', '&Weiter >')

    [/autoit]

    Gruß
    Greenhorn

  • Komplette Zeile aus Textdatei löschen

    • Greenhorn
    • 29. Februar 2008 um 23:08

    Na siehste, ... geht doch ! ;):D:thumbup:


    Gruß
    Greenhorn

  • Script mit Tasten STARTEN und beenden...

    • Greenhorn
    • 29. Februar 2008 um 21:28

    Vielleicht in Zusammenarbeit hiermit ...
    http://www.autohotkey.com/

    Gruß
    Greenhorn

  • pls help: GUI transparent menu image , -NO buttons

    • Greenhorn
    • 29. Februar 2008 um 18:52

    So geht's ... ;)

    Spoiler anzeigen
    [autoit]

    $hWnd = GUICreate('Mein unsichtbarer GUI Button', 170, 215, -1, -1, $WS_POPUP)
    $pic = GUICtrlCreatePic(@ScriptDir & '\AMMenuTrans3003.jpg', 0, 0, 170, 215, -1, $GUI_WS_EX_PARENTDRAG)
    GUICtrlSetTip(-1, '... verschieb mich !')
    $btnHidRed = GUICtrlCreateLabel('', 68, 160, 35, 35)
    GUICtrlSetBkColor(-1, $GUI_BKCOLOR_TRANSPARENT )
    GUICtrlSetState(-1, $GUI_ONTOP)
    $btnHidYellow = GUICtrlCreateLabel('', 20, 65, 35, 35)
    GUICtrlSetBkColor(-1, $GUI_BKCOLOR_TRANSPARENT )
    GUICtrlSetState(-1, $GUI_ONTOP)
    $btnHidBlue = GUICtrlCreateLabel('', 115, 20, 35, 35)
    GUICtrlSetBkColor(-1, $GUI_BKCOLOR_TRANSPARENT )
    GUICtrlSetState(-1, $GUI_ONTOP)

    [/autoit] [autoit][/autoit] [autoit]

    GUISetState()

    [/autoit] [autoit][/autoit] [autoit]

    While 1

    $nMsg = GUIGetMsg()

    Switch $nMsg
    Case $GUI_EVENT_CLOSE
    Exit
    Case $btnHidRed
    MsgBox(0, '', 'Der rote Button wurde gedrückt.')
    Exit
    Case $btnHidBlue
    MsgBox(0, '', 'Der blaue Button wurde gedrückt.', 2)
    Case $btnHidYellow
    MsgBox(0, '', 'Der gelbe Button wurde gedrückt.', 2)
    EndSwitch

    WEnd

    [/autoit]

    Gruß
    Greenhorn

    Bilder

    • AMMenuTrans3003.jpg
      • 14,54 kB
      • 170 × 215
  • Komplette Zeile aus Textdatei löschen

    • Greenhorn
    • 29. Februar 2008 um 17:18

    z.B. ...

    Code
    [Blackrock Revolution]
    	DNS=Blackrock-Revolution.de
    	Server1=127.000.000.1
    	Server2=192.168.000.1

    Deine *.ini kannst Du frei gestalten, so wie's dir passt ...

    Du musst dir eine Struktur ausdenken ...

    Gruß

  • pls help: GUI transparent menu image , -NO buttons

    • Greenhorn
    • 29. Februar 2008 um 16:03

    Du kannst das Fenster auch einfacher verschiebbar machen ...
    Jedenfalls, wenn Du ein Bild als Hintergrund hast, dann kannst Du es mit '$GUI_WS_EX_PARENTDRAG' machen:

    [autoit]

    $Pic = GUICtrlCreatePic('', 0, 0, 635, 476, BitOR($SS_NOTIFY, $WS_GROUP, $WS_CLIPSIBLINGS), $GUI_WS_EX_PARENTDRAG)

    [/autoit]

    Gruß
    Greenhorn

  • Komplette Zeile aus Textdatei löschen

    • Greenhorn
    • 29. Februar 2008 um 15:54

    Dann poste doch mal ein Beispiel deiner settings.txt, dann sehen wir uns das mal an ... ;)

    Gruß

  • Komplette Zeile aus Textdatei löschen

    • Greenhorn
    • 29. Februar 2008 um 15:45
    Zitat

    die settings.txt soll eigentlich erstellt werden wenn nich vorhaden und is von dem script, NICHT von wow


    Dann speicher deine Werte doch einfach in eine settings.ini ! ;)
    Die kannst Du viel besser handlen als eine .txt, da kannst Du dann nach Herzenslust löschen, ändern, neu erstellen ...

    Code
    [Server_1]
    	IP=127.000.000.1
    [Server_2]
    	IP=192.168.000.1
    [Server_3]
    	IP=85.214.34.170

    Gruß
    Greenhorn

  • Komplette Zeile aus Textdatei löschen

    • Greenhorn
    • 29. Februar 2008 um 15:19

    Ist die 'settings.txt' von dir selbst erstellt oder wird sie von WoW mitgebracht ?

    Gruß
    Greenhorn

  • veränderbares Bild klickbar machen

    • Greenhorn
    • 29. Februar 2008 um 14:33

    Den Call-Aufruf habe ich gestern Abend erst eingebaut ..., vorher hatte ich es über Execute gemacht, das funzte aber nur ohne Parameter für die Funktionen. ;)

    Nun geht's.

    Spoiler anzeigen
    [autoit]

    Func _PicButtonFromFile($hWnd, $controlID, $defaultPic, $onHoverPic, $onClickPic, $Function = '', $parameters = '')

    [/autoit] [autoit][/autoit] [autoit]

    If StringInStr($parameters, ',') Then
    $parameters = StringSplit($parameters, ',')
    $parameters[0] = 'CallArgArray'
    EndIf
    Local $resFunc
    If $onClickPic = '' Or $onClickPic = -1 Then $onClickPic = $onHoverPic
    $cMsg = GUIGetCursorInfo($hWnd)
    If $cMsg[4] = $controlID Then
    GUICtrlSetImage( $controlID, $onHoverPic)
    $cMsg = GUIGetCursorInfo($hWnd)
    While $cMsg[4] = $controlID
    If GUIGetMsg() = $controlID Then
    GUICtrlSetImage( $controlID, $onClickPic)
    If $parameters Then
    $resFunc = Call($Function, $parameters)
    Else
    $resFunc = Call($Function)
    EndIf
    EndIf
    Sleep(10)
    $cMsg = GUIGetCursorInfo($hWnd)
    WEnd
    GUICtrlSetImage($controlID, $defaultPic)
    Return $resFunc
    EndIf

    [/autoit] [autoit][/autoit] [autoit]

    EndFunc ;==>_PicButtonFromFile

    [/autoit]

    Gruß
    Greenhorn

  • Komplette Zeile aus Textdatei löschen

    • Greenhorn
    • 29. Februar 2008 um 00:46

    Vielleicht genügt auch schon ein einfacher StringReplace, wenn es nicht so viel ist ...

    Spoiler anzeigen
    [autoit]

    $sRepl = @LF & 'Server 2 ; IP 2' & @CR
    $fhText = FileOpen('Text', 0)
    $sText = FileRead($fhText)
    $sNewText = StringReplace($sText, $sRepl)
    FileWrite(@ScriptDir & '\TextNeu.txt', $sNewText)
    FileClose($fhText)

    [/autoit]

    Gruß
    Greenhorn

Spenden

Jeder Euro hilft uns, Euch zu helfen.

Download

AutoIt Tutorial
AutoIt Buch
Onlinehilfe
AutoIt Entwickler
  1. Datenschutzerklärung
  2. Impressum
  3. Shoutbox-Archiv
Community-Software: WoltLab Suite™